Geographic Location of Bhejiput


The village Bhejiput is located in Purusottampur Police Station Jurisdiction of Ganjam District in the State of Odisha in India. It is governed by Chingudighai Gram Panchayat. It comes under Purusottampur Community Development Block. The nearest town is Kodala, which is about 9 kilometers away from Bhejiput.

Social Structure of Bhejiput


As per available data from the year 2009, 483 persons live in 99 house holds in the village Bhejiput. There are 268 female individuals and 215 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 55.49% and males constitute 44.51% of the total population.

There are 28 scheduled castes persons of which 12 are females and 16 are males. Females constitute 42.86% and males constitute 57.14%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 5.8% of the total population.

Population density of Bhejiput is 1788.89 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Bhejiput

Total area of Bhejiput is 27 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 21.36 ha. About 21.36 ha is un-irrigated area.

About 5.25 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 0.04 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ands. About 0.35 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.
